Ujjain, Madhya Pradesh: The world-famous Shri Mahakaleshwar Temple witnessed a divine and majestic sight during the Tuesday early-morning Bhasma Aarti, as the doors of the sanctum were opened for devotees.

Following the traditional Panchamrit pujan, priests performed the Kapoor Aarti. Lord Mahakal was adorned in a royal form, decorated with a silver trident, sacred Tripundra, and bhang, enhancing the grandeur of the ritual.

Sacred Abhishek and Panchamrit Worship

In the Nandi Hall, Nandi Maharaj was first bathed, meditated upon, and worshipped.

Lord Mahakal was then given a ceremonial bath with water, followed by Panchamrit prepared from milk, curd, ghee, sugar, honey, and fruit juices.

The deity was offered a silver moon, silver trident crown, bhang, sandalwood paste, dry fruits, and sacred ash.

Traditional Ornaments and Floral Decoration

Lord Mahakal was adorned with a silver Sheshnag crown, a silver skull garland, Rudraksha mala, and a fragrant floral garland, adding to the divine splendour of the Jyotirlinga.

Devotees also witnessed the offering of fruits and sweets as part of the bhog.

Bhasma Aarti Amid Devotional Chants

The Bhasma Aarti was performed with the rhythmic sounds of jhanjh, manjira, and damru, filling the temple premises with devotion.

A large number of devotees attended the Aarti and sought blessings from Baba Mahakal.

As per tradition, sacred ash was offered to Lord Mahakal by the Maha Nirvani Akhada.
